Gender Orientation
An individual's internal sense of their own gender, whether they identify as male, female, both, neither, or along a gender spectrum.
Achievement Motivation
The drive or inner motivation a person has to strive for success, accomplishment, or mastery in tasks, often measured by persistence and effort.
Projective Test
A type of personality test in which the individual's responses to ambiguous stimuli are analyzed to uncover unconscious desires, feelings, or conflicts.
Task Difficulty
The level of challenge presented by a task, which can affect how much effort and time is needed to successfully complete it.
